**Vendor note: Inkmill markdown pipeline**

Rendering for Parchway docs is outsourced to Inkmill under an annual contract, renewing each March. They handle sanitization and PDF export; we own the upload queue. SLA: 4-hour response on rendering failures. Escalate only after two failed retries. Their support desk is reachable at the address below.

billing contact of hahaf-baguf = zorael.tammir.jorius@sivrelhq.internal

Handing over the Crateline pick-list optimizer to you. The solver recalculates routes every fifteen minutes; be careful with the aisle-weight config, since stale weights quietly degrade pick times. Always run the simulation harness before deploying changes, and compare against last week's baseline. The deployment steps and baseline archive are documented on the internal page below.

operations page: https://jira.qorvelsys.internal/browse/pages/browse/pages

Subject: Spare Parts Shipment — Karnsville Pump Station

Dear dispatch team,

The crate contains three impeller assemblies, gasket kits, and the replacement control relay for the Karnsville Pump Station. Please verify each item against the enclosed packing list before sealing, as the site has no nearby supplier and any shortage means a two-week delay. The courier from Tollbridge Express has been briefed on the access road conditions and will call ahead. When the courier arrives at the gate, follow the hand-over instruction given below exactly.

handover note for yagef-bagep: the drudor pelius courier leaves the kasdor zorvan norir ledger at gate 8016 under passcode 755406